The two England-based stars were outstanding as Nigeria powered to victory over their hapless visitors on Friday afternoon
Leicester City’s Kelechi Iheanacho and Everton FC’s Alex Iwobi have been adjudged to be the two best players on the pitch when the Super Eagles forced a 2-0 defeat down the throat of Liberia at the Teslim Balogun Stadium.
Gernot Rohr’s men dominated the encounter for the most part, with a few brilliant individual performances littered all over the pitch.
But Iheanacho took the shine off everyone else, scoring a pair of well-taken goals in the 22nd and 44th minutes to help Nigeria begin the race to Qatar 2022 on a fantastic note.
The ex-Manchester City ace was adjudged the game’s Man of the Match and was given a cheque of N1million by NFF partner 33 Export.
The equally excellent Iwobi had a hand in both of Iheanacho’s goals and was also presented with a cheque of N1million as the Most Valuable Player of the Match.
With the win over Liberia’s Lone Star, the Super Eagles sit top of Group C ahead of their matchday two clash against Cape Verde at the Estádio Municipal Adérito Sena in Mindelo on September 7.
Another win over the Blue Sharks will see the Super Eagles seize control of the group with six points.
